...a self-contained spacious property for a two/four in the heart of the Loire Valley, open to families, can comfortably sleep 4 people.

Walk in through the stable-style front door into the large, open plan living area decorated with a reclaimed log burner and a vintage bike high up on the beam! A large modern oil painting specially commissioned by a local artist completes this eclectic mix of old and new.

This 200 year old building which once housed a wine press has recently been sympathetically restored by professional builders to provide modern, spacious one bedroom accommodation  for  couples or for family of four*.

* Children aged 8 and upwards for the mezzanine. Younger children can use the sofa bed and a put me up bed in the lounge.

The property retains the charm of bygone times and also benefits from the added luxuries one would expect in the 21st century such as underfloor heating and a dishwasher.

The main accommodation (apart from the mezzanine) is entirely on the ground floor and comprises:

A large cathedral-style living room with a dining area and a well appointed fitted kitchen (dishwasher, microwave, small electric oven, four-ring hob and extractor fan, electric kettle, filter coffee maker, toaster).

There’s a flat screen television with satellite channels, a DVD player and DVDs as well as books.

To accommodate 2 children/teenagers/adults there are two single beds on the mezzanine.

Bedroom (groundfloor)

The lounge leads to a dressing area (large in-built wardrobes, with lots of hanging and storage space) and the light and airy double bedroom with chest of drawers and bedside tables. Door to the garden.

Bathroom

To the other side of the dressing area, there’s a large family-size bathroom with a sunken bath and shower, double vanity unit with two washhand basins, heated towel rail and toilet. There is also a washing machine, iron and ironing board.
